Output aaf52ec399ed495c88411f3dbda68d56207343a4053e587dbf0ae5daa3d1bd54:0

value
66536691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a1a39dc3af53a97102b59d0efabab575895ea34 OP_EQUAL
address
MWhaabx25NMJ4pcozC3U6rQTaXm16g6kb8
transaction
aaf52ec399ed495c88411f3dbda68d56207343a4053e587dbf0ae5daa3d1bd54
spent
true